49/**
50 * \brief List element type
51 */
52struct list_element {
53 struct list_element *next;
54};
55
56/**
57 * \brief List head type
58 */
59struct list_descriptor {
60 struct list_element *head;
61};
62
63/**
64 * \brief Reset list
65 *
66 * \param[in] list The pointer to a list descriptor
67 */
68static inline void list_reset(struct list_descriptor *const list)
69{
70 list->head = NULL;
71}
72
73/**
74 * \brief Retrieve list head
75 *
76 * \param[in] list The pointer to a list descriptor
77 *
78 * \return A pointer to the head of the given list or NULL if the list is
79 * empty
80 */
81static inline void *list_get_head(const struct list_descriptor *const list)
82{
83 return (void *)list->head;
84}
85
86/**
87 * \brief Retrieve next list head
88 *
89 * \param[in] list The pointer to a list element
90 *
91 * \return A pointer to the next list element or NULL if there is not next
92 * element
93 */
94static inline void *list_get_next_element(const void *const element)
95{
96 return element ? ((struct list_element *)element)->next : NULL;
97}
98
99/**
100 * \brief Insert an element as list head
101 *
102 * \param[in] list The pointer to a list element
103 * \param[in] element An element to insert to the given list
104 */
105void list_insert_as_head(struct list_descriptor *const list, void *const element);
106
107/**
108 * \brief Insert an element after the given list element
109 *
110 * \param[in] after An element to insert after
111 * \param[in] element Element to insert to the given list
112 */
113void list_insert_after(void *const after, void *const element);
114
115/**
116 * \brief Insert an element at list end
117 *
118 * \param[in] after An element to insert after
119 * \param[in] element Element to insert to the given list
120 */
121void list_insert_at_end(struct list_descriptor *const list, void *const element);
122
123/**
124 * \brief Check whether an element belongs to a list
125 *
126 * \param[in] list The pointer to a list
127 * \param[in] element An element to check
128 *
129 * \return The result of checking
130 * \retval true If the given element is an element of the given list
131 * \retval false Otherwise
132 */
133bool is_list_element(const struct list_descriptor *const list, const void *const element);
134
135/**
136 * \brief Removes list head
137 *
138 * This function removes the list head and sets the next element after the list
139 * head as a new list head.
140 *
141 * \param[in] list The pointer to a list
142 *
143 * \return The pointer to the new list head of NULL if the list head is NULL
144 */
145void *list_remove_head(struct list_descriptor *const list);
146
147/**
148 * \brief Removes the list element
149 *
150 * \param[in] list The pointer to a list
151 * \param[in] element An element to remove
152 *
153 * \return The result of element removing
154 * \retval true The given element is removed from the given list
155 * \retval false The given element is not an element of the given list
156 */
157bool list_delete_element(struct list_descriptor *const list, const void *const element);
